The project is centered on the Design and prototypation of a set of ceramic artifacts.

In the brief, great importance was given to the unique gesture related to the use of an object. For this reason the design approach was strongly based on gestures and rituality.

The heart of 5hot's concept is based on conviviality and consumption rituals. It is a search for the interactin between the gestures of use and the use itsef.

Extremely interesting for the project is the attention paid to social relationships and interactions that arise in the context and, above all, in the act of drinking.
The concept and, consequently, the formal research are entirely based on the enjoyment and modes of interaction in these contexts, which develop around the playfulness and hilarity of shared moments.


As previously mentioned, the use of shots is to be defined as communal. This is because the very act of enjoying the dish implies group participation and, at the same time, a distortion of the original form-s state of tranquillity. In this sense, the funcioning is closely linked to the use of each glass in its singularity> each of the glasses is stable when accompanied by at least one other element, but falls and consequently spills its contents if it remains alone and therefore undrunk.

The curved base of the glasses makes them tip over if they don’t have support from the others.
This unique feature forces the user to consume in company.
A shape that reflects togetherness and the need for the user to interface with collective participation.



Since the brief aimed to reach a semi-industrial production process, several prototypes in gres and porcelain have been made. The creation of the prototype started with digital modeling and 3D development of the shape on Grasshopper, based on the Voronoi diagram.
Once the five final solids had been obtained, the next step was to create the plaster mold. Once filed and cleaned, the mold in question was closed so that the slip could be poured into it.
